Description | Footage from the Royal Society's expedition to the Solomon Islands.
Contents: On board the chartered ship from Fiji. Collecting specimens; including sea urchin. Collecting specimens in the shallows. Diving. Ship setting off. 10 min: Smoking, cutting rock for fossils. 12 min: Snorkeling amongst coral. Taking coral specimens. 13 min: Tree climbing and chopping of branches. 14 min 30: Digging hole for soil sampling. 16 min: Soil specimens; men holding the legs of a scientist to stop him falling in the hole while he takes samples. 16 min 30: Mountain top view. 17 min 13: A view of the ship. 17 min 30: Taking specimens from tree trunks.. 19 min: Setting sail in the ship.
